What does a remote seismic data processing geophysicist do?

A Remote Seismic Data Processing Geophysicist specializes in analyzing seismic data, often from a remote location, to help interpret subsurface geological structures. They use advanced software and algorithms to process raw seismic signals collected during surveys, improving the quality and clarity of the data. Their work is crucial in industries such as oil and gas exploration, environmental studies, and earthquake research. By working remotely, they leverage digital tools to collaborate with teams and deliver results without being on-site.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ote seismic data processing geophysicist?

To thrive as a Remote Seismic Data Processing Geophysicist, you need a strong background in geophysics, seismic interpretation, and quantitative analysis, usually supported by a relevant degree such as geophysics, geology, or physics. Proficiency with seismic processing software (e.g., ProMAX, Petrel, or SeisSpace), programming languages (such as Python or MATLAB), and experience with remote collaboration tools are typically required. Strong anal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help professionals excel in interpreting complex datasets and reporting findings to multidisciplinary teams. These skills ensure accurate seismic data analysis, efficient remote collaboration, and effective contribution to exploration or monitoring projects.

What are some common challenges faced by remote seismic data processing geophysicists, and how can they be managed?

Remote Seismic Data Processing Geophysicists often encounter challenges such as managing large data sets, ensuring data quality, and troubleshooting processing software issues without on-site support. Effective communication with field teams and clients is crucial to clarify data requirements and resolve discrepancies quickly. Staying updated with the latest processing techniques and maintaining strong organizational skills help manage project deadlines and deliver accurate results. Collaboration tools and regular virtual meetings are commonly used to facilitate teamwork and overcome the limitations of remote work.

As a Data Platform Engineer, you will design, build, and operate the core data services that power our products and analytics. You'll own end-to-end data pipelines and API services that ingest, process, and expose high-quality data to internal customers (data science, analytics, product, and other engineering teams) and external partners.

You'll be part of a small, high-impact team that treats the data platform as a product with strong SLAs, and reliable self-service for internal and external users.

Responsibilities

What you'll do:

  • Architect and implement entity resolution logic to de-duplicate and link disparate data points into unified "Golden Records" for businesses and individuals
  • Design and maintain a high-performance global business knowledge graph and ontology to map complex ownership chains, UBOs, and hidden risk relationships across international borders
  • Implement a hybrid storage strategy that bridges graph databases for relationship mapping with document and search stores for rich metadata and adverse media content
  • Optimize the platform for real-time risk assessment, ensuring the ability to traverse multiple levels of ownership in milliseconds to support automated "Go/No-Go" onboarding decisions
  • Design and build scalable data services and APIs for ingesting, transforming, and serving data across the company
  • Develop and maintain batch and streaming data pipelines using modern data processing frameworks and AWS cloud-native tooling
  • Own the reliability, performance, and API first data platform, including monitoring, alerting, and on-call where appropriate
  • Implement best practices for data modeling, quality, lineage, and governance to ensure trustworthy, well-documented datasets
  • Work closely with data scientists, analysts, and application engineers to understand their needs and translate them into robust platform capabilities
  • Drive automation and standardization through CI/CD, model as a service, and reproducible environments
  • Help define and evolve the architecture of our data platform as a true internal service with clear contracts, SLAs, and versioned APIs

Requirements

    • Expertise in Graph Ecosystems: Hands-on experience with Graph databases (e.g., Neo4j, AWS Neptune, or TigerGraph) and query languages like Cypher or Gremlin
    • Identity & Linkage Mastery: Proven experience with Entity Resolution or Record Linkage (e.g., using tools like Senzing, Quantexa, or custom probabilistic matching models)
    • Schema Design: Ability to design flexible ontologies that handle evolving regulatory data (e.g., changing PEP definitions or Sanction list formats)
    • API Performance for Graphs: Experience building GraphQL or REST APIs specifically optimized for graph traversals and deep-tree lookups
    • Experience building centralized data platforms or "data-as-a-service" offerings at scale (e.g., at a large tech or cloud-native company)
    • Strong software engineering skills in at least one language commonly used for data and services (e.g., Python, Java, Go, Rust)
    • Hands-on experience building data pipelines and ETL/ELT workflows on a major cloud provider (AWS preferred)
    • Experience with modern data stack tools such as Spark/Flink, Kafka/Kinesis, Airflow/managed schedulers, and data warehouses (e.g., Snowflake, Redshift, BigQuery, Databricks)
    • Familiarity with DevOps practices: CI/CD, containerization (Docker), orchestration (Kubernetes), and infrastructure-as-code (Terraform)
    • Strong focus on observability (metrics, logs, traces), resilience, and building early warning signals
    • Comfort collaborating cross-functionally and communicating clearly with both technical and non-technical stakeholders.
